Introduction by WGC
Phil, has been with sport since the early days. He was responsible for running The Tropicana - very hard and very successfully X Training events. He enters the events these days having recovered from a previous injury and is slowly moving on up the UKXTA rankings after each event. Phil can often be seen as one of the few competitors who smiles during an event. That is not to say all the others have no sense of humor, its just very hard to smile when you are in so much pain!

Acheivements...

Run John ' 0' Groats to Lands end in a week. 882miles run 26miles carrying 55kg bag of sand on back. Ran with a telegraph pole on my shoulders for 26miles. e.tc.all for charity

Qualifications...

Army physical training instructor. Personal Trainer. Martial Arts Instructor. Body Pump & Spinning Instructor. Paramedic

On X-Training...

How long have you been X-Training?
I did very first ever Xtraining about 12 yrs ago. I have had 3yrs off due to Paramedic training and shoulder injury. Been back doing x-training for a year.

Why do you find X-Training so exciting?
I love the training for the comps .I love the buzz at the comps.Ii love the challenge. Also I like to mix with other gym gladiators.

Phil Piggott

Do you teach X-Training to your clients?
Yes I do, i got Paul Morton into x-tra comps last yr. So far he has won two out of 4 intermediates comps. He will be stepping up to open for Hampshire Comp. Watch out for him on the run. He will be a top masters by next yr.

What are their views on X-Training?
They love it, gives them motivation to train, also they get fast results.

Who has been your biggest influence in X-Training?
All the older guys that were around 10 yrs ago, Rob Volpe, Steve Quick, and the main man himself Mr Hywell Davies,

How often do you train?
I have to train around my long 12 hour shifts, at least 3 times a week, but I train 100% when I train.

What is your favorite exercise?
I like the pull-ups, & bench press the best.

What is your favorite food for training?
Weat a bix

What is your ambition in X-Training?
To win over all in a big x-training comp - not just the masters. Also to win the national comp. I have reached my short term goal which was to get into top ten masters, in a yr, next is to be number one master.

What exercise secret would you give a newcomer to X-Training?
Remember, 'repetition is the mother of mastery' train on your weakest exercise so it becomes your strength.
